1Now faith is the substance of things hoped for, the evidence of things not seen. 2For by it the elders obtained a good report. 3Through faith we understand that the worlds were framed by the word of God, so that things which are seen were not made of things which do appear.
Hebrews 11:1-3, King James Version

Lonely Road of Faith

A series of devotions on the lonely road of faith would not be complete without considering The Great Hall of Faith found in Hebrews 11.

As we are speaking of faith, we will look into the hope and faith of those listed in Hebrews. Many are not mentioned by name, but their blind faith brought about persecution in this life, but great rewards in the life to come.



A Christian without faith is not a Christian! We all have lapses in our faith; sometimes our faith may ebb and wane, but the Christian life is a life of faith. We come to God in faith, we read and understand His Word through faith, and we walk every day of our lives with faith that this world is not our home. Our true home waits for us in heaven above where we will live with God forever.

Lonely Road of Faith What is faith? According to Hebrews 11:1, the substance of our faith is based upon things we hope for, and the evidence of our faith can not be seen. What kind of faith is that? Just think about that for a moment; true faith is a gift of God. The world can not understand Christians! Christians base their whole value system on things they hope for with no concrete evidence sitting right before their eyes.

Lonely Road of Faith Yes, it may seem foolish, but to the Christian it is the power of God unto salvation. It has always been this way from the beginning of time. The elders who received a good report were those who exhibited faith.

The world thinks it strange that Christians believe in a God who created this world in just six days. Yet, how ludicrous is it that the intricate life we see in plant, animals, and especially ourselves just happened by chance. It takes more "faith" to believe a lie than to believe the truth!

As we walk through this chapter in the next several devotions, I hope and pray that your faith as well as mine will be strengthened, as we look at the lives of those who walked the lonely road of faith.

What an amazing God we have!
